Why is Railroad Valley Unique?


Railroad Valley contains a mineral-rich evaporite deposit that formed over a 3 million year period.  The deposit contains both liquids (brine) and solid salts, and this makes the deposit quite unique.  It is one of the largest such deposits in the world, and the most significant in North America.  South America and China have similar deposits, and these locations are the worlds current source of lithium, a strategic mineral for the USA.
